II. Historical Evolution of Advertising
A. Early Forms of Advertising
Advertising, in different forms, has been an important part of human history considering that ancient times. Early civilizations used primary methods to promote items and services, leveraging basic interaction strategies to reach prospective consumers. Some early kinds of advertising consist of:
- Pictorial Signage: In ancient marketplaces, traders utilized pictorial signs and symbols to identify their stores and suggest the products they offered. These visual cues functioned as an early kind of branding and assisted illiterate individuals acknowledge businesses.
- Town Criers: In medieval Europe, town criers played a vital function in distributing details and advertising events. They would publicly reveal news, proclamations, and commercial messages, acting as human "speakers" for companies and authorities.
- Handbills and Posters: In the 17th and 18th centuries, printed handbills and posters ended up being popular advertising tools. These advertising materials were plastered on walls, trees, and other public areas to inform the local neighborhood about items, services, and events.
B. The Birth of Modern Advertising
The Industrial Revolution in the 19th century produced significant changes to the advertising landscape. Improvements in technology and mass production, combined with the growth of urban centers, developed new opportunities for companies to reach bigger audiences. Secret turning points in the birth of contemporary advertising include:
- Newspapers and Magazines: With the rise of industrialization and the printing press, newspapers and publications emerged as prominent advertising platforms. Companies started placing paid ads in publications, targeting particular demographics based upon readership.
- Branding and Logos: As competitors increased, organizations acknowledged the need for differentiation. They began adopting logo designs and mottos to develop brand identities that consumers could recognize and trust.
- Advertising Agencies: In the late 19th century, the first advertising agencies were established, marking a shift from private services managing their promos to customized firms using advertising services. These firms brought a more strategic and innovative approach to advertising.

Search Engine Marketing (SEM)
Search Engine Marketing (SEM) is a type of paid advertising that aims to increase a website's exposure on search engine results pages (SERPs). It includes bidding on particular keywords relevant to the business, and when users look for those keywords, the ads appear on top or bottom of the search results page. SEM can be highly efficient as it targets users actively looking for products or services related to the marketer's offerings. Google Ads (previously referred to as Google AdWords) is the most popular platform for SEM, however other search engines like Bing likewise use similar advertising chances.
